Jackson - TheLeonardLeap - 03-09-2022 (03-09-2022, 10:21 AM)Ell Prez Wrote: I would love to sign Jackson. He’s one of the best CB in the nfl. INT machine. We need that. If we signed him and 2 OL I would be extremely happy. Cutting Mixon saves only $3.17m in cap space. Next year is the first year Mixon could potentially be cut with a $12.85m cap hit and cutting him would save $7.35m. Cutting Boyd saves more, but then you're turning a strength into a weakness and putting yourself into a situation where either a really late 2nd-4th round rookie WR has to perform immediately as a starter or you're giving large amounts of offensive snaps to Trent Taylor/Auden Tate/Stanley Morgan.
